Skyrim DLC leak – snow elves and crossbows

28 April 2012

Bethesda marketing vice president Pete Hines tweeted on Thursday that we’ll possibly be getting some info on the Skyrim DLC next week.

This had everyone pretty worked up, as we’re all expecting big things from the DLC. Last year game director Todd Howard promised a DLC with an “expansion pack feel”, something a little meatier than the usual fare.

Of course the internet is full of kids who like to sneak under the Christmas tree and shake their presents, and once again those not content with waiting around have gone under the hood to see what they can find.

Some gamers on the Skyrim forums have uncovered series of strings buried in the most recent patch which reference crossbows, a snow elf prince and vampire feeding animations. According to the posts, the files were in a subfolder not-too-subtly-labeled “DLC01”, so it’s probably safe to assume you’ll be able to shoot a snow elf prince in the face with a crossbow in the near future.
